Compare Moses Lake to Wenatchee

This post compares Moses Lake, Washington to Wenatchee, Washington across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Moses Lake (city) Wenatchee (city)
Population 22,038 33,544
Income (median) $42,115 $37,936
Home Value (median) $149,400 $221,800
White 75% 86%
Black 1% 0%
Asian 2% 0%
With Kids 39% 31%
Age (median) 31 35
Rentals 47% 42%
